Nominated as the best travel destination to visit in 2019, Sri Lanka reaches new heights in the tourism industry. Nestled on the Southern nation of the Indian Ocean, this precious jewel encircles myriad enchantments. Being a land gifted by coastal areas, wetlands, moorlands, greeneries and dry…